General Education Compliance: Trapping Colleges in Uncharted Territory
After the sociology courses vanished, institutions were forced to recalculate core course ratios. In my consulting work, I’ve seen colleges scramble to adjust their compliance matrices, often creating spreadsheets that look more like maze maps than strategic tools.
A compliance matrix is a table that cross-references every general education requirement with the courses that satisfy it. Without transparent documentation, accrediting officials may misinterpret coverage, leading to prolonged appeals cycles. I once helped a college that spent six months defending its curriculum simply because the matrix was buried in a shared drive and not updated after the policy change.
To avoid that trap, I recommend building a real-time dashboard that pulls data from the registration system. Each semester, the dashboard shows the percentage of credits earned in each core category. When a category dips below the state-mandated threshold, an alert pops up for the dean of curriculum.
Embedding this dashboard into the daily workflow creates a culture of continuous compliance. Faculty can see, at a glance, whether their new course proposals will fill a gap or create an overlap. Administrators can allocate resources to develop new electives that meet the missing criteria, such as a quantitative reasoning module that integrates data science concepts.
Moreover, the dashboard can generate exportable reports for accreditation visits. Auditors love seeing live data that matches the institution’s narrative. When the evidence is readily available, the review process shortens, and the risk of losing program status diminishes dramatically.
In my experience, colleges that treat compliance as a one-time checklist end up with audit nightmares. Treating it as a living system, updated each registration cycle, transforms compliance from a burden into a strategic advantage.
Accreditation Audit Checklist: Building a Fault-Proof Template
When I first drafted an audit checklist for a Florida community college, I realized that most templates mixed narrative descriptions with raw numbers, making it hard for auditors to find what they needed. A fault-proof checklist separates the two, pairing concise qualitative statements with solid quantitative metrics.
The first column lists each core requirement - communication, quantitative reasoning, natural sciences, and social/behavioral sciences. The second column describes how the institution meets the requirement, citing specific courses and learning outcomes. The third column provides enrollment data: total credits earned, percentage of student body covered, and trend over the past three years.
Training audit teams on this template reduces subjectivity. I run workshops where reviewers practice scoring a mock curriculum using the checklist. The result is a shared language: “We have a 78% inclusion rate for quantitative reasoning, which exceeds the 70% threshold.” This clarity prevents debates over whether a course counts.
All evidence - course syllabi, faculty qualifications, assessment reports - is stored in a shared digital repository, such as a cloud-based learning management system. During an accreditation visit, the audit team can pull a document with a single click, rather than hunting through paper files.
Implementing this template has saved institutions weeks of preparation time. One college reported cutting its audit preparation from 45 days to 12 days after adopting the checklist and repository system.
In short, a well-designed checklist acts like a road map for both the institution and the accrediting body, ensuring that every decision aligns with federation-approved standards and that no hidden gaps slip through.
College General Education Standards: Evolutions That Signal Trouble
Federal pressure to diversify core topics is reshaping general education curricula across the nation. In my recent review of a Florida state college, I saw administrators adding electives on environmental justice and digital citizenship to satisfy new diversity mandates.
However, without a cross-disciplinary council, these additions can become isolated silos. Auditors often ask, “How do these electives integrate with the rest of the curriculum?” If the answer is “they don’t,” it signals a lack of interdisciplinary competency - a red flag that can stall accreditation.
To avoid this, I help colleges form curriculum councils that include faculty from humanities, sciences, and professional schools. These councils meet quarterly to evaluate how new courses align with learning outcomes and core requirements. The council’s minutes become part of the audit documentation, showing intentional design.
Annual external peer reviews add another layer of safety. I arrange for peer reviewers from other institutions to examine the general education program and provide feedback. Their reports often highlight emerging gaps before the accrediting agency does.
When colleges commit to these practices, they create a feedback loop that catches deviations early. The result is a resilient curriculum that can adapt to policy changes - like the removal of sociology - without compromising accreditation standards.
